As you had skin symptoms after coming in contact with the
cat,so allergy to cats cannot be ruled out.In the last trimester
of pregnancy,
cat allergens cannot pose a direct risk to your baby but it may effect fetal well being by causing allergy symptoms like skin symptoms,hives,itching,respiratory symptoms to life threatening anaphylaxis in the mother.
I would suggest that you get rid of the cat as far as possible.If not possible then,use reputable allergy avoidance products throughout your home.
